Présentation du produit
The Honeywell 900C30S-0460 is a high-performance HC900 C30 Controller CPU, specifically designed for complex process automation and hybrid control applications. Part sur the HC900 family, this model provides modularity, scalability, and powerful logic processing capabilities in a compact and efficient package. It is ideal for industries requiring precise control, data acquisition, and reliable performance in harsh industrial environments.
This C30 CPU variant supports broad connectivity, integrates seamlessly with I/O modules and operator stations, and is engineered to control up to hundreds sur analog and digital I/O points. Whether for thermal processing, batch production, or environmental monitoring, the 900C30S-0460 delivers trusted Honeywell quality and performance at the core sur process automation systems.
Spécifications du produit
| Parameter | Details |
|---|---|
| Modèle Number | 900C30S-0460 |
| Product Type | HC900 C30 Controller CPU |
| Series | Honeywell HC900 Hybrid Control System |
| CPU Type | C30 (Compact CPU) |
| Memory | 10 MB non-volatile memory |
| I/O Capacity | Up to 960 I/O points |
| Supported I/O Types | Analog In/Out, Digital In/Out, Thermocouples, RTDs |
| Scan Rate | Typically 25 ms per 100 PID loops |
| Programming Interface | Ethernet via Hybrid Control Designer (HCD) |
| Communications | Modbus TCP, Serial Modbus RTU, Peer-to-Peer, OPC via Experion |
| Redundancy Support | Not supported (single CPU only) |
| Power Supply Input | 24 VDC |
| Mounting Type | DIN Rail |
| Operating Temperature Range | 0°C to 60°C (32°F to 140°F) |
| Storage Temperature | -40°C to 85°C (-40°F to 185°F) |
| Humidity Range | 5% to 95% RH, non-condensing |
| Shock/Vibration Resistance | IEC 60068 compliant |
| Certifications | CE, UL, CSA, FM, ATEX Zone 2, Class 1 Div 2 |
| Dimensions (HxWxD) | 89 × 56 × 46 mm |
| Poids | 0.54 kg |
| Programming Ssurtware | Honeywell Hybrid Control Designer |

Questions fréquentes (FAQ)
-
Q: What is the difference between 900C30S-0460 and other C30 models?
A: The 0460 variant may include updated firmware or specific configuration tailored for broader application requirements compared to earlier C30 versions. -
Q: Can this CPU be used in safety-critical applications?
A: No, the 900C30S-0460 is not SIL-rated. For safety applications, use Honeywell’s HC900 Safety controllers. -
Q: What is the maximum number sur I/O points supported?
A: This controller supports up to 960 I/O points depending on the rack and modules used. -
Q: Does the C30 support redundant CPU operation?
A: No, redundancy is not available on the C30. The C70 model surfers redundancy. -
Q: How do I program this controller?
A: Use Honeywell’s Hybrid Control Designer ssurtware via Ethernet connection. -
Q: Is it compatible with SCADA or DCS systems?
A: Yes, it supports Modbus TCP/RTU and OPC via integration with Honeywell Experion or other SCADA systems. -
Q: What power supply is required?
A: It operates on 24 VDC input power. -
Q: Can I use it in explosive environments?
A: Yes, the unité is certified for Class 1 Div 2 and ATEX Zone 2 installations. -
Q: Is remote I/O supported?
A: Yes, remote I/O expansion is supported via Honeywell’s 900R modules. -
Q: What happens during a power failure?
A: The controller retains non-volatile memory and resumes operation upon power restoration.
